TRUST Psalm 118:8-9

It is better to take refuge in the LORD than to trust in humans. It is better to take refuge in the LORD than to trust in princes.

It is better to take refuge in the LORD 
Psalm 2:11-12  Serve the LORD with fear and celebrate his rule with trembling. Kiss his son, or he will be angry and your way will lead to your destruction, for his wrath can flare up in a moment. Blessed are all who take refuge in him.
Psalm 5:11  But let all who take refuge in you be glad; let them ever sing for joy. Spread your protection over them, that those who love your name may rejoice in you.
Psalm 9:9  The LORD is a refuge for the oppressed, a stronghold in times of trouble.
Psalm 37:3  Trust in the LORD and do good; dwell in the land and enjoy safe pasture.
Psalm 40:4  Blessed is the one who trusts in the LORD, who does not look to the proud, to those who turn aside to false gods.
Isaiah 25:4-5  You have been a refuge for the poor, a refuge for the needy in their distress, a shelter from the storm and a shade from the heat. For the breath of the ruthless is like a storm driving against a wall and like the heat of the desert. You silence the uproar of foreigners; as heat is reduced by the shadow of a cloud, so the song of the ruthless is stilled.
Isaiah 57:13  "When you cry out for help, let your collection of idols save you! The wind will carry all of them off, a mere breath will blow them away. But whoever takes refuge in me will inherit the land and possess my holy mountain."

than to trust in humans 
2 Chronicles 32:7-8  "Be strong and courageous. Do not be afraid or discouraged because of the king of Assyria and the vast army with him, for there is a greater power with us than with him. With him is only the arm of flesh, but with us is the LORD our God to help us and to fight our battles." And the people gained confidence from what Hezekiah the king of Judah said.
Psalm 108:12  Give us aid against the enemy, for human help is worthless.
Isaiah 2:22  Stop trusting in mere humans, who have but a breath in their nostrils. Why hold them in esteem?

than to trust in princes 
Psalm 146:3  Do not put your trust in princes, in human beings who cannot save.
